General Information

Title: All Glory, laud, and honour
Composer: Melchior Teschner
Arranger: Andrew Hawryluk
Tune: St Theodulph
Lyricist: Theodulf of Orléans , circa 820 (Gloria, laus, et honor)
Translator: John Mason Neale, 1851.

Number of voices: 4vv   Voicing: TTBB
Genre: SacredHymn   Meter: 76. 76. D

Language: English
Instruments: A cappella
